Introduction to Personal Gardeners

A personal gardener, often referred to as a private gardener, is an individual hired to care for and maintain the gardens or yards of private residences. Unlike public gardeners who work in parks and other communal green spaces, personal gardeners work directly with homeowners to ensure their outdoor spaces are meticulously maintained and reflect their personal style and preferences. The role of a personal gardener is multifaceted, requiring a blend of horticultural knowledge, physical ability, and sometimes, creative flair.

Responsibilities of a Personal Gardener

The duties of a personal gardener can vary widely depending on the size of the garden, its complexity, and the homeowner’s specific needs. However, some common responsibilities include:
– Lawn care: This encompasses mowing, edging, fertilizing, and pest control to keep the lawn healthy and visually appealing.
– Plant care: Personal gardeners are responsible for the health and well-being of plants, including watering, pruning, and protecting them from pests and diseases.
– Garden design and planning: For those looking to revamp their garden, a personal gardener can offer advice on plant selection, layout, and other design elements to create a cohesive and beautiful space.
– Maintenance of garden features: This includes cleaning and maintaining ponds, fountains, and other water features, as well as caring for paths, driveways, and other hard landscaping elements.

Choosing the Right Personal Gardener

Selecting the right personal gardener is crucial to ensure that the care and maintenance of your garden meet your expectations. When searching for a personal gardener, consider the following factors:
Experience and Qualifications: Look for individuals with formal training in horticulture or extensive experience in gardening.
References and Reviews: Ask for references from previous clients and check online reviews to get an insight into the gardener’s work quality and reliability.
Insurance and Liability: Ensure that the gardener has appropriate insurance coverage to protect against accidents or damages to your property.
Communication: Good communication is key. Choose a gardener who is open to discussing your needs, preferences, and any concerns you may have.

Interviewing Potential Gardeners

When interviewing potential gardeners, prepare a list of questions to help you assess their suitability for the job. This might include inquiries about their experience with plants similar to yours, their approach to garden maintenance, and how they handle common gardening challenges.

How often should I schedule visits from my personal gardener?

The frequency of visits from your personal gardener will depend on the size and complexity of your garden, as well as your personal preferences and budget. For smaller gardens, a monthly or bi-monthly visit may be sufficient, while larger gardens may require more frequent visits, such as weekly or every 10 days. The time of year can also impact the frequency of visits, with more frequent visits typically required during peak growing seasons.

It’s essential to communicate with your personal gardener to determine the optimal visit schedule for your garden. They can assess your garden’s needs and provide recommendations for the frequency and duration of visits. Some personal gardeners may offer flexible scheduling options, such as one-time visits, ongoing maintenance contracts, or seasonal packages, which can be tailored to your specific needs and budget. By scheduling regular visits from your personal gardener, you can ensure that your garden receives the care and attention it needs to thrive throughout the year.
